President Barack Obama and Michelle Obama’s media company Higher Ground is ending its exclusive podcast deal with Spotify, Bloomberg reports and Pitchfork has learned. The Obamas are reportedly shopping around for a different podcasting partner to replace Spotify when the agreement ends in October 2022. Spotify declined to make a new offer to the Obamas as they reportedly pursue deals with companies including Amazon and iHeartMedia. The multi-year deal was originally signed back in 2019.

The Obamas’ podcasts for Spotify included Renegades: Born in the USA, a series of conversations between President Barack Obama and Bruce Springsteen, and The Michelle Obama Podcast, a series of deep conversations between the former First Lady and loved ones.
